The Origin of Clouds derives from an experiment to study the formation of clouds that appeared within the larger context of weather phenomena research at the end of the nineteenth century. The Cloud Chamber or Camera Nebulosa was originally built to create artificial clouds in the laboratory and investigate their emergence in the atmosphere. The experiment failed in explaining this phenomenon and was never able to provide a better understanding of clouds, storms or lighting. However, the Camera Nebulosa made an unexpected discovery by enabling the visualization of fundamental particles for the first time. This so-called “failed experiment” became the visual proof of the existence of the sub atomic world and had a profound influence on the research within the field of atomic energy. The Origin of Clouds documents the process by which fundamental particles become form and materiality. The visual result is an ever-changing flux of ephemeral shapes with unpredictable occurrence that emphasizes the phenomenon’s organizational logic in space and time.
